Abstract
A horn mold insert is applied to a product which needs glue to enter in a lurking mode in a mold. The mold comprises a male mold core and a female mold core. The horn mold insert comprises a mold insert, a top block, a runner and a pouring gate. The mold insert is arranged inside the male mold core. The top surface of the mold insert is connected with the top surface of the male mold core. The top block is arranged inside the male mold core and closely adjacent to one side of the mold insert. An extending portion is arranged at the top end of the top block in the horizontal direction. The extending portion is arranged on the top surface of the top block and the top surface of the male mold core. One part of the runner is arranged on the joint portion of the top surface of the mold insert and the extending portion, and the other part of the runner is arranged on the joint portion of the top surface of the male mold core and the extending portion. The size of the cross section of the runner reduces gradually. The pouring gate is arranged on the joint of the tip of the runner and the product. The horn mold insert enables ejection of a double injection mold to be simplified, achieves forming of some products which have a longer horn runner and some products which include glass fiber materials, shortens production cycle of the mold, improves efficiency and lowers cost.
